Description:
This is a fine LC Smith 2E shotgun made in 1901 , it has Crown Steel 26 inch barrels . All matching serial numbers . Right barrel is .006 restriction . left barrel is .009 restriction . LOP is 14 inches , drop at heel is 2.5 inches , at toe 1.75 inches . Chambers are 2 3/4 inch , it has ejectors and a 2 position safey . Weight is 6 lbs , 10 oz.   Serial #5107 , made in March of 1901 .  Factory letter is included . Condition of bores is excellent , no pitting , dents or corrision , shiney and as good as day they were made . Fine line checkering still sharp and complete . Traces of case color on action . Barrels contain 98% blueing and no dents . This gun is in excellent condition . I have shot it several times with modern Fiocchi and Winchester low recoil target loads . It easily smokes the claybirds out to 40 yards . This is a very fine Classic American Shotgun . Made at a time when manufacturing had no equal then or today .
